Latin Borrowings

Match the words with their definitions.

AB
ad hocformed or used for a particular purpose or for immediate needs
ad homineman attack on an opponent's character
alter egoa trusted friend or personal representative; the opposite side of a personality
de factoactual, what is being used rather than what is legally true
de jureby right of law
ex post factodone, made, or formulated after the fact
modus operandia usual way of doing something
a priorirelating to or derived by reasoning from self-evident propositions
bona fidemade in good faith, without deceit
carpe diemenjoy the pleasures or opportunities of the moment without concern about the future
caveat emptorbuyer beware
corpus delectibody of evidence; a dead body
curriculum vitaeresume; list of academic accomplishments
aquilinecurving like an eagle's beak
asininefoolish, brainless
caninerelating to dogs
bovinerelating to cows: placid or unemotional
felinerelating to cats
leoninerelating to lions
porcinepiglike
vulpinefoxlike; sneaky, clever, crafty
